FirstLife Pty Ltd (Marsh)

Comments on FirstLife Pty Ltd (Marsh). Shop 3, 1000 Pittwater Rd, Collaroy 2097 NSW
Please share as much information as you can about FirstLife Pty Ltd (Marsh) so other users can benefit from your comment.
Can't read?